@@ -1,6 +1,25 @@
+2009-09-06 Richard Frith-Macdonald <rfm@gnu.org>
+
+ * Source/NSRunLoop.m: Fix for rare problem if someone changes the
+ system time backwards.
+ * configure.ac: Check for pthread.h and type sizes. Insist on having
+ pthread.h in order to build, now that it is a requirement.
+ * configure: Regenerate
+ * Headers/Additions/GNUstepBase/GSConfig.h.in: Declare abstract types.
+ * Source/NSLock.m: including pthread.h
+ * Headers/Foundation/NSLock.h: Avoid including pthread.h
+ Basically, insist on finding pthread.h at configure time, and get size
+ of essential types so we can avoid exposing them directly in our
+ public headers. This should discourage developers from using things
+ they shouldn't, but it does not solve the issue that copies of the base
+ library built with different pthread implementations on the same
+ platform may have binary incompatible NSLock classes (with respect to
+ subclassing as the pthread specific ivars differ in size). However
+ this is *really* unlikely to be an issue in practice.
